* tdb: add TDB_MUTEX_LOCKING supportVolker Lendecke2014-05-221-0/+68
| |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| This adds optional support for locking based on shared robust mutexes. The caller can use the TDB_MUTEX_LOCKING flag together with TDB_CLEAR_IF_FIRST after verifying with tdb_runtime_check_for_robust_mutexes() that it's supported by the current system. The caller should be aware that using TDB_MUTEX_LOCKING implies some limitations, e.g. it's not possible to have multiple read chainlocks on a given hash chain from multiple processes. Note: that this doesn't make tdb thread safe! * tdb: workaround starvation problem in locking entire database.Rusty Russell2010-08-141-0/+60
| |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| We saw tdb_lockall() take 71 seconds under heavy load; this is because Linux (at least) doesn't prevent new small locks being obtained while we're waiting for a big log. The workaround is to do divide and conquer using non-blocking chainlocks: if we get down to a single chain we block. Using a simple test program where children did "hold lock for 100ms, sleep for 1 second" the time to do tdb_lockall() dropped signifiantly. There are ln(hashsize) locks taken in the contended case, but that's slow anyway. More analysis is given in my blog at http://rusty.ozlabs.org/?p=120 This may also help transactions, though in that case it's the initial read lock which uses this gradual locking routine; the update-to-write-lock code is separate and still tries to update in one go.
